2022电赛声源定位(基础篇)

对于需要2022电赛题目的同学点击这个链接:https://pan.baidu.com/s/1zyC8MbgenAAQ_ZVmvFyZvg
提取码:g6kd

对于这个2022电赛E题声源定位的音频点击这个链接:https://pan.baidu.com/s/1fNRSU9LOXzB-ES2JFoFizg
提取码:lmy7

这个音频是一个扫频信号,是一个单通道采样率为10k的信号,频率范围是500-2000 hz,对于使用的主控芯片是stm32F407VET6,具有168MHZ的主频,512K的FLASH,192K的SRAM,当然假如开启了DMA的模式,然后有不修改相关配置,那么你的SRAM就是128K,只有原来的2/3.

 从这个图我们可以看到有64K的独立SRAM,他是不能被DMA访问的,当然一份STM32数据手册有1751页,没有几年经验是看不完的,只有不断接触到新的项目,才会不断接触这些小小的细节。

对于音频的处理,当然是越大越好,但考虑到STM32的性能以及博主的能力有限,没有压榨完全STM32的性能,采用了2048点的FFT,目前对于STM32自带的库只能运行4096的FFT,当然对于这个点数可能已经在压榨STM32的边缘,所以官方给的库也只能处理这么大,不过STM32自带的一个库感觉运算出的结果与MATLAB的结果相差无几,对于MATLAB我感觉还是有点点小小的狗,因为他通常会自己保留三位有效数字,自己四舍五入,STM32出来的结果都比MATLAB精确ÿ

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

GD32开发者

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值